The Water Supply (Water Fittings) Regulations were introduced in 1999 to prevent misuse, waste, undue consumption or erroneous measurement of water. Most importantly, they are designed to prevent contamination of drinking water supplies.
You will be trained to carry out water fittings inspections at both customer properties and commercial premises to ensure that installed plumbing systems are compliant, identifying risks to water quality and identifying any issues relating to the waste, undue consumption, or misuse of our water.
